MATHS AT ESKDALE

 

Students will have the opportunity to work in pairs and small groups, as well as individually, to solve a variety of challenging problems 

The main areas of Mathematics are:- Number, Algebra, Shape and Space, Handling Data and Using & Applying Mathematics.

Students are grouped according to their ability. The class size varies from year to year. There are three 1 hour lessons each week.

Homework is set weekly and tasks are set appropriate to the age group and year.

 

YEAR 8 and YEAR 9 ABLE, GIFTED AND TALENTED

Students have the opportunity to attend weekly after school sessions to enable them to take G.C.S.E. Foundation Level Statistics examination at the end of Year 9.

Mathematics staff visit and liaise with all local Primary Schools to ensure proper progression from KS2 to KS3. Primary Schools visit our school to take part in Mathematical Thinking Skills days.

Students may take part in orienteering and field work activities as part of cross curricular days
